How long was your first jump course?
Southern_Man replied to lopullterri's topic in Safety and Training
I was at a wedding like that once. The preacher kept saying, "'til DEATH do you part" every other minute or so. I believe my FJC was about 7 hours. The included a lunch break and a few other breaks as well. From 8am until somewhere around 3. I did not get to jump that day (weather) and I believe I got another hour or so with my two instructors before I jumped. "What if there were no hypothetical questions?" -

With only 160 jumps he can only have a B-license. I would point him to the SIM, which shows that a B-license holder should have a re-currency jump if he has not jumped for 90 days. Ultimately it is up to the drop-zone to enforce that. "What if there were no hypothetical questions?"

The Forerunner is great but is much more than just a heart rate monitor. It comes with a higher price tag. I've used a Polar for my heart rate monitor. The watch that came with my model has a built in stop-watch with some split time capabilities as well. I've not had the built-in footpod on any of my running items. I think either work okay, just be sure they features on the model you buy are what you want. "What if there were no hypothetical questions?"
